Featured reviews:

🇵🇭

Mary

8.2

January 2025

The breakfast provided was quite good. The restaurant staff was very helpful. The rooms were small, with little luggage space, but they were kept clean and all the essential amenities were provided (coffee, tea, toiletries, charging stations, etc.). The hotel has a laundry area, vendo machine, lounge, and a playroom for guests. Tsukiji train station is only about 5 min away on foot. A convenience store is a few steps away. We highly recommend trying the Oyster and Shell Ramen & the small Yakiniku place nearby.

It would have been nice if they provided restaurant recommendations or places to visit nearby.

🇶🇦

Matthew

8.2

April 2025

Generally okay for a 3 star hotel. The family room was good. There are a few metro stations nearby. If you can walk well, and you have a subway pass, it's a good location. On the negative, breakfast is okay, not great and incredibly busy. It stops at 09:00-09:30 which is much too early, resulting in it being far too busy at 08:30. The lifts are terrible. They take ages. The hotel blocks one of three lifts after 08:30 which makes the wait horrendous in the morning.
